Output ec3c296d5c6f1de898333bdc10feb59c1df1135be21fa7fc0efe58f907953344:0

value
10934789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d72eeb0efdaed75d5805613fe49e64202664e5 OP_EQUALVERIFY OP_CHECKSIG
address
mhbiwUEKjeoze3A3xwuC7MweyS6J9XcyGc
transaction
ec3c296d5c6f1de898333bdc10feb59c1df1135be21fa7fc0efe58f907953344